Lot Description

A Victorian silver mounted glass vanity bottle of spherical form, the open work silver formed as putti amongst birds, masks and floral scrolls, hallmarked James Deakin & Sons (John & William F Deakin) Chester 1900, height measuring 5 ¼ inches (13.5 cm). Together with a Victorian silver mounted jar, hallmarked Birmingham 1897 and a Victorian silver mounted scent bottle. (3).

All items display general scratches, marks, wear and tarnishing commensurate with the age and use. Further wear is visible to the silver with loss of definition and dents, the small scent bottle displays significant dents and tears to the silver. The glass vanity bottle is missing the stopper. Chips visible to the glass. The hallmarks appear rubbed but legible.
